An 8-channel 2.5 mA current source is a device or circuit that is capable of supplying a constant current of 2.5 mA (milliamperes) on each of its 8 channels simultaneously. Each channel can be independently controlled to deliver a specific current level.
This type of current source is commonly used in various applications, including electronics, instrumentation, and signal processing. It can be used to bias transistors, drive LEDs, or provide current references for analog circuitry.
The 8-channel capability means that the current source can provide individual currents to up to 8 different loads or devices simultaneously. This allows for greater flexibility and efficiency in multi-channel systems or when multiple components require a constant current source.
The 2.5 mA current specification indicates the desired current level for each channel. It means that each channel can provide a steady current of 2.5 mA, regardless of the load impedance within its operating limits.
It's worth noting that the implementation of an 8-channel 2.5 mA current source can vary depending on the specific application and requirements. It could be implemented using discrete components, integrated circuits (ICs), or programmable devices, such as microcontrollers or digital-to-analog converters (DACs), depending on the complexity and control requirements of the system.
